Night shift: all visitors must sign in at the Corvane Plaza desk, no exceptions. Note the east wing door sensors are under recall by the supplier, so several doors won't auto-release after hours. Escort visitors via the main atrium only. Do not prop recalled doors. Log any sensor faults in the overnight book for Facilities. Until replacement units arrive, use the manual override keypad with the code below.

turnstile pass: bdg-MWRUHE-76377440

Heads up: this alert fires when the revamped password reset flow on Lockridge starts timing out. We swapped the old email-token system for the new Keywicket magic-link service last sprint, and it's still a bit twitchy under load. If you see more than 20 failures in 5 minutes, check the Keywicket queue depth first — it's almost always that. Don't restart the worker pool without reading the notes. The triage steps are on the internal page right here.

wiki page, tahaf-tajog: https://jira.ordindyn.corp/pipeline

Ticket #—missed pick-up. The two raffle drums for the Fennick & Lowe staff party were not collected yesterday; the driver logged the dock as closed. Drums are now with reception, wrapped and labelled. Party is Friday, so re-booking is urgent. The rescheduled courier hand-over instruction is as follows:

drop instructions, bagag-kafof: the ulaion wenax courier leaves the aldeth ledger at gate 6755 under passcode 507500